Do It with Flair: Unleash Your Spark & Own the Room

Do it with flair transforms everyday tasks into expressive achievements that people remember. This approach invites you to blend confidence, creativity, and precision in every action you take.

Instead of rushing through routines, you pause to consider impact, audience, and the subtle details that elevate ordinary work to standout results. The following sections outline practical ways to bring flair into your projects, communications, and professional presence.

Define Your Flair: Style With Intention

Flair begins with a clear sense of identity and audience expectation. When you understand your own strengths and the context you are entering, your choices in tone, design, and structure become deliberate rather than accidental. This alignment between intent and execution is the foundation of visible, memorable flair.

Personal Brand Anchors

Identify signature elements, such as phrasing patterns, visual motifs, or values, that consistently appear in your best work. These anchors help you stay recognizable while adapting to different challenges and audiences.

Craft Standout Content With Precision

Content with flair balances clarity with a distinctive voice. You combine tight logic, vivid examples, and a confident narrative flow so that complex ideas feel accessible and engaging. The result is material that not only informs but also invites attention and action.

Revision Rhythm

Treat revision as a core creative phase. Draft boldly, then refine for brevity, tone, and impact, ensuring every sentence or visual element earns its place in the final output.

Design And Execution That Captivate

Visual and operational flair emerge from thoughtful structure, disciplined layout, and responsive problem solving. Consistent spacing, deliberate color choices, and clear information architecture guide people smoothly toward the outcomes you intend.

Execution Checklist

Use compact checklists for quality, timing, and ownership to keep creative energy focused and projects moving predictably from concept to delivery.

Make Flair A Repeatable Advantage

Treat flair as a disciplined practice rather than a one-off style choice, integrating it into standards, reviews, and learning loops so it consistently supports your objectives.

  • Clarify intent and audience before choosing style elements
  • Balance creativity with clarity in messaging and design
  • Establish lightweight guidelines that teams can apply consistently
  • Test, measure, and refine flair based on real-world feedback
  • Anchor bold decisions to core objectives and measurable outcomes

How do I start introducing flair into my daily work without overwhelming my team?

Pick one recurring task, define a simple style guideline, pilot it with a small group, collect feedback, and iterate before scaling across the team.

Can flair work in data-heavy or highly regulated industries?

Yes, in these contexts, flair shows up through clear information hierarchy, purposeful visuals, and precise language that clarifies complexity while respecting compliance requirements.

What is the biggest mistake people make when trying to be more flamboyant at work?

Prioritizing spectacle over substance, which can dilute credibility; align bold choices with clear value, relevance, and audience needs.

How do I measure whether my flair is improving results rather than just looking different?

Track engagement, completion rates, stakeholder satisfaction, and downstream decisions, then compare trends before and after applying deliberate flair.
